InSSIDer Wi-Fi Network Scanner

I used to have NetStumbler for Wi-Fi network scanning but it doesn't run on Windows 7 OS. Its development seems to have stalled. The newer InSSIDer network scanner runs natively on this new OS. It's interface shows the detected Access Points' signal strength graph in two panes. Aside from 2.4 GHz , it is also able to scan the 5 GHz spectrum.


Overall, the software is very good and it's FREE. It is downloadable from http://www.metageek.net/.
